An Cosán An Cosán (Irish for “The Path”) is Ireland’s largest community education organisation. Its mission is to promote social equality and end poverty through community-based adult education, early years supports, wraparound counselling services, and social enterprise development. The Early Years Department operates seven services across Dublin City—three in Cabra, three in Tallaght, and one in Whitehall. An Cosán follows the HighScope Approach, an evidence-based curriculum proven to deliver improved outcomes for children and provides training to all educators in its implementation.
